Sheep's Green: A Tranquil Escape in Cambridge
Discover the tranquility of Sheep's Green, Cambridge's hidden gem for nature lovers and those seeking peaceful outdoor experiences.
Sheep's Green is a serene city park in Cambridge, ideal for nature lovers and those seeking a peaceful retreat. With its lush greenery and scenic views, visitors can enjoy leisurely walks, picnics, and a chance to connect with nature amidst the vibrant city life.
